/* *  Licensed to the Apache Software Foundation (ASF) under one or more *  contributor license agreements.  See the NOTICE file distributed with *  this work for additional information regarding copyright ownership. *  The ASF licenses this file to You under the Apache License, Version 2.0 *  (the "License"); you may not use this file except in compliance with *  the License.  You may obtain a copy of the License at * *      http://www.apache.org/licenses/LICENSE-2.0 * *  Unless required by applicable law or agreed to in writing, software *  distributed under the License is distributed on an "AS IS" BASIS, *  WITHOUT WARRANTIES OR CONDITIONS OF ANY KIND, either express or implied. *  See the License for the specific language governing permissions and *  limitations under the License. * */package org.apache.tools.ant.taskdefs.optional.clearcase;import org.apache.tools.ant.BuildException;import org.apache.tools.ant.Project;import org.apache.tools.ant.taskdefs.Execute;import org.apache.tools.ant.types.Commandline;import org.apache.tools.ant.taskdefs.condition.Os;/** * Task to perform mkattr command to ClearCase. * <p> * The following attributes are interpreted: * <table border="1"> *   <tr> *     <th>Attribute</th> *     <th>Values</th> *     <th>Required</th> *   </tr> *   <tr> *      <td>viewpath</td> *      <td>Path to the ClearCase view file or directory that the command will operate on</td> *      <td>Yes</td> *   <tr> *   <tr> *      <td>replace</td> *      <td>Replace the value of the attribute if it already exists</td> *      <td>No</td> *   <tr> *   <tr> *      <td>recurse</td> *      <td>Process each subdirectory under viewpath</td> *      <td>No</td> *   <tr> *   <tr> *      <td>version</td> *      <td>Identify a specific version to attach the attribute to</td> *      <td>No</td> *   <tr> *   <tr> *      <td>typename</td> *      <td>Name of the attribute type</td> *      <td>Yes</td> *   <tr> *   <tr> *      <td>typevalue</td> *      <td>Value to attach to the attribute type</td> *      <td>Yes</td> *   <tr> *   <tr> *      <td>comment</td> *      <td>Specify a comment. Only one of comment or cfile may be used.</td> *      <td>No</td> *   <tr> *   <tr> *      <td>commentfile</td> *      <td>Specify a file containing a comment. Only one of comment or cfile may be used.</td> *      <td>No</td> *   <tr> *   <tr> *      <td>failonerr</td> *      <td>Throw an exception if the command fails. Default is true</td> *      <td>No</td> *   <tr> * </table> * */public class CCMkattr extends ClearCase {    private boolean mReplace = false;    private boolean mRecurse = false;    private String mVersion = null;    private String mTypeName = null;    private String mTypeValue = null;    private String mComment = null;    private String mCfile = null;    /**     * Executes the task.     * <p>     * Builds a command line to execute cleartool and then calls Exec's run method     * to execute the command line.     * @throws BuildException if the command fails and failonerr is set to true     */    public void execute() throws BuildException {        Commandline commandLine = new Commandline();        Project aProj = getProject();        int result = 0;        // Check for required attributes        if (getTypeName() == null) {            throw new BuildException("Required attribute TypeName not specified");        }        if (getTypeValue() == null) {            throw new BuildException("Required attribute TypeValue not specified");        }        // Default the viewpath to basedir if it is not specified        if (getViewPath() == null) {            setViewPath(aProj.getBaseDir().getPath());        }        // build the command line from what we got. the format is        // cleartool mkattr [options...] [viewpath ...]        // as specified in the CLEARTOOL help        commandLine.setExecutable(getClearToolCommand());        commandLine.createArgument().setValue(COMMAND_MKATTR);        checkOptions(commandLine);        if (!getFailOnErr()) {            getProject().log("Ignoring any errors that occur for: "                    + getViewPathBasename(), Project.MSG_VERBOSE);        }        // For debugging        // System.out.println(commandLine.toString());        result = run(commandLine);        if (Execute.isFailure(result) && getFailOnErr()) {            String msg = "Failed executing: " + commandLine.toString();            throw new BuildException(msg, getLocation());        }    }    /**     * Check the command line options.     */    private void checkOptions(Commandline cmd) {        if (getReplace()) {            // -replace            cmd.createArgument().setValue(FLAG_REPLACE);        }        if (getRecurse()) {            // -recurse            cmd.createArgument().setValue(FLAG_RECURSE);        }        if (getVersion() != null) {            // -version            getVersionCommand(cmd);        }        if (getComment() != null) {            // -c            getCommentCommand(cmd);        } else {            if (getCommentFile() != null) {                // -cfile                getCommentFileCommand(cmd);            } else {                cmd.createArgument().setValue(FLAG_NOCOMMENT);            }        }        if (getTypeName() != null) {            // type            getTypeCommand(cmd);        }        if (getTypeValue() != null) {            // type value            getTypeValueCommand(cmd);        }        // viewpath        cmd.createArgument().setValue(getViewPath());    }    /**     * Set the replace flag     *     * @param replace the status to set the flag to     */    public void setReplace(boolean replace) {        mReplace = replace;    }    /**     * Get replace flag status     *     * @return boolean containing status of replace flag     */    public boolean getReplace() {        return mReplace;    }    /**     * Set recurse flag     *     * @param recurse the status to set the flag to     */    public void setRecurse(boolean recurse) {        mRecurse = recurse;    }    /**     * Get recurse flag status     *     * @return boolean containing status of recurse flag     */    public boolean getRecurse() {        return mRecurse;    }    /**     * Set the version flag     *     * @param version the status to set the flag to     */    public void setVersion(String version) {        mVersion = version;    }    /**     * Get version flag status     *     * @return boolean containing status of version flag     */    public String getVersion() {        return mVersion;    }    /**     * Set comment string     *     * @param comment the comment string     */    public void setComment(String comment) {        mComment = comment;    }    /**     * Get comment string     *     * @return String containing the comment     */    public String getComment() {        return mComment;    }    /**     * Set comment file     *     * @param cfile the path to the comment file     */    public void setCommentFile(String cfile) {        mCfile = cfile;    }    /**     * Get comment file     *     * @return String containing the path to the comment file     */    public String getCommentFile() {        return mCfile;    }    /**     * Set the attribute type-name     *     * @param tn the type name     */    public void setTypeName(String tn) {        mTypeName = tn;    }    /**     * Get attribute type-name     *     * @return String containing type name     */    public String getTypeName() {        return mTypeName;    }    /**     * Set the attribute type-value     *     * @param tv the type value     */    public void setTypeValue(String tv) {        mTypeValue = tv;    }    /**     * Get the attribute type-value     *     * @return String containing type value     */    public String getTypeValue() {        return mTypeValue;    }    /**     * Get the 'version' command     *     * @param cmd CommandLine containing the command line string with or     *                    without the version flag and string appended     */    private void getVersionCommand(Commandline cmd) {        if (getVersion() != null) {            /* Had to make two separate commands here because if a space is               inserted between the flag and the value, it is treated as a               Windows filename with a space and it is enclosed in double               quotes ("). This breaks clearcase.            */            cmd.createArgument().setValue(FLAG_VERSION);            cmd.createArgument().setValue(getVersion());        }    }    /**     * Get the 'comment' command     *     * @param cmd containing the command line string with or     *        without the comment flag and string appended     */    private void getCommentCommand(Commandline cmd) {        if (getComment() != null) {            /* Had to make two separate commands here because if a space is               inserted between the flag and the value, it is treated as a               Windows filename with a space and it is enclosed in double               quotes ("). This breaks clearcase.            */            cmd.createArgument().setValue(FLAG_COMMENT);            cmd.createArgument().setValue(getComment());        }    }    /**     * Get the 'commentfile' command     *     * @param cmd         containing the command line string with or     *                    without the commentfile flag and file appended     */    private void getCommentFileCommand(Commandline cmd) {        if (getCommentFile() != null) {            /* Had to make two separate commands here because if a space is               inserted between the flag and the value, it is treated as a               Windows filename with a space and it is enclosed in double               quotes ("). This breaks clearcase.            */            cmd.createArgument().setValue(FLAG_COMMENTFILE);            cmd.createArgument().setValue(getCommentFile());        }    }    /**     * Get the attribute type-name     *     * @param cmd containing the command line string with or     *        without the type-name     */    private void getTypeCommand(Commandline cmd) {        String typenm = getTypeName();        if (typenm != null) {            cmd.createArgument().setValue(typenm);        }    }    /**     * Get the attribute type-value     *     * @param cmd containing the command line string with or     *        without the type-value     */    private void getTypeValueCommand(Commandline cmd) {        String typevl = getTypeValue();        if (typevl != null) {            if (Os.isFamily("windows")) {                typevl = "\\\"" + typevl + "\\\""; // Windows quoting of the value            } else {                typevl = "\"" + typevl + "\"";            }            cmd.createArgument().setValue(typevl);        }    }    /**     * -replace flag -- replace the existing value of the attribute     */    public static final String FLAG_REPLACE = "-replace";    /**     * -recurse flag -- process all subdirectories     */    public static final String FLAG_RECURSE = "-recurse";    /**     * -version flag -- attach attribute to specified version     */    public static final String FLAG_VERSION = "-version";    /**     * -c flag -- comment to attach to the element     */    public static final String FLAG_COMMENT = "-c";    /**     * -cfile flag -- file containing a comment to attach to the file     */    public static final String FLAG_COMMENTFILE = "-cfile";    /**     * -nc flag -- no comment is specified     */    public static final String FLAG_NOCOMMENT = "-nc";}
